Sourdough crispbread chips provide 530 calories per 100 g. The same amount contains 101 g of carbohydrates, 12 g of protein, 6 g of fat, and 8 g of fiber.
Sourdough crispbread chips have a glycemic index of 68, indicating a moderate-to-high glycemic impact. They contain gluten and are compatible with vegan, vegetarian, Mediterranean, flexitarian, and omnivorous diets.
